Abstract

PURPOSE:To eliminate miscopying due to difference of sheet size, by memorizing the sheet size during continuous copying, and providing a controller for restartin the continuous copying when the sheets are replenished and after comparison of both sizes, their accordance is conformed. CONSTITUTION:When an operator sets an amt. of continuous copying, data on the sheet size, etc. detected with sheet size detection switches 2a, 3a are memorized in RAM 12. When the sheets are used up before the completion of the copy set amt., and the operator replenishes the sheets, or selects another sheet feed tray, CPU10 judges that the continuous copying is on operation in accordance with the contents stored in RAM 12, and sends a control signal for restarting the continuous copying to start it. At this signal of CPU 10, when the size is different from that before the suspension, even if a use permission display device 13 displays ''copy OK'', the restart of continuous copying is not executed.
